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Fort Crockett
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Fort Crockett?
Actualmente hay 167 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Fort Crockett, TX con precios que van desde $532 hasta $8,451. También hay 113 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Fort Crockett que van desde $850 hasta $4,200.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Fort Crockett?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Fort Crockett oscilan entre $850 hasta $4,200 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,992.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Fort Crockett?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Fort Crockett o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$3,033,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,350 hasta $4,200.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,975 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,895.
